Parts list
Main components, grouped by system.
Bike components
Frame
Frame
Series 3 DSX, Supension Adjusted Geometry, 6061 Aluminum, Tapered Head Tube, Relieved BB, Internal Cable Routing, Mudguard and Rack Mounts, Flat Mount Disc, 142x12mm Thru-Axle
Suspension Fork
SR/Suntour GVX LOR, 60mm Travel, Air Spring, Rebound Adjust, Lockout, Integrated Fender Mounts

Fit data
Numbers for sizing and ride feel.
| Size | SM | MD | LG | XL |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Stack Reach Ratio | 1.46 mm | 1.42 mm | 1.44 mm | 1.45 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Height | 277.5 mm | 277.5 mm | 277.5 mm | 277.5 mm |
| Front Center | 653 mm | 685 mm | 711 mm | 737 mm |
| Rake | 47 mm | 47 mm | 47 mm | 47 mm |
| Trail | 87 mm | 87 mm | 87 mm | 87 mm |
| Stack | 579.2 mm | 597.8 mm | 625.7 mm | 653.6 mm |
| Reach | 396 mm | 421 mm | 436 mm | 451 mm |
| Top Tube Length | 563.23 mm | 593.6 mm | 616.6 mm | 639.6 mm |
| Seat Tube Angle | 74 ° | 74 ° | 74 ° | 74 ° |
| Seat Tube Length | 430 mm | 480 mm | 520 mm | 558 mm |
| Head Tube Angle | 68.5 ° | 68.5 ° | 68.5 ° | 68.5 ° |
| Head Tube Length | 100 mm | 120 mm | 150 mm | 180 mm |
| Chainstay Length | 421 mm | 421 mm | 421 mm | 421 mm |
| Wheelbase | 1061 mm | 1093 mm | 1119 mm | 1145 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Drop | 82 mm | 82 mm | 82 mm | 82 mm |
| Standover Height | 663 mm | 704 mm | 734 mm | 757 mm |
| Wheels | 700 | 700 | 700 | 700 |
| Rider Min Height | 157 cm | 166 cm | 176 cm | 185 cm |
| Rider Max Height | 169 cm | 179 cm | 188 cm | 193 cm |

Fork
The DSX FS comes factory-installed with the Suntour GVX fork. This has a travel range of 60mm. Bike forks are perfect to absorb shocks and provide a great riding experience overall. To sum it all, when buying a bike, ensure that you look for a fork capable of decent travel.
Wheels
When it comes to wheels, the DSX FS bike is equipped with the 700c aluminum model. These are the most popular wheels for road, aero, gravel, cyclocross, race, and gravel bikes. However, while they give you great speed and control, these wheels are not so bump-friendly.
Brakes
For your safety, it is important to have quality breaks on your bike. Marin DSX FS has Hydraulic Disc brakes installed. Hydraulic disc brakes provide amazing stopping power, no matter what the terrain. To sum up, your safety is in good hands.
